Nothing like an edit is from an obscure acid jazz track that made its rounds in the underground disco scene in Chicago. Played by veterans like Sadar, Lee Collins & Ron Trent at clubs like Slicks & the B-Side Café. Don't Cha Wanna get down is a rare groove monster chopped from a Funk 45 and kicks off with tights drums, bass licks and crazy synths coupled with some sick brass stabs and a touch of vocals that keeps it all in check and make you wanna get down, get down. Played by: Rahaan, Theo Parrish, Ron Trent, Marcellus Pittman, Jamie 3:26, Kai Alce', Zernell & Soul Clap.
